The high counts of M pachydermatis obtained from the axillae, groins and claw folds of the Sphynx cats exceeded those of healthy Devon Rex cats (DRC), Cornish Rex cats (CRC) and domestic shorthair (DSH) cats; axillary populations were comparable to those of seborrheic DRC. Because Malassezia thrives in a lipid-rich environment, the accumulation of sebum on the skin surface and in the skin folds of the Sphynx creates an ideal environment for Malassezia to grow in an uncontrolled manner, disrupting the normal microbiota living on the skin. This is not due to the overproduction of skin oil by the sebaceous gland, but rather due to the absence of hair that will wick oil away from the skin surface in furry-coated animals. Since Malassezia live in the top layer of the skin, medicated shampoos containing antiseptic ingredients such as chlorhexidine and an antifungal ingredient such as miconazole are the most common treatment modality. It is often associated with underlying conditions such as hypersensitivity skin diseases, metabolic diseases, neoplasia (the formation of tumours), and paraneoplastic syndromes (conditions that occur as a result of cancer). In furry animals, the hair wicks the oils away from the skin, preventing a build-up of oily secretion, but in the sphynx, the oil has nowhere to go and accumulates on the surface of the skin and between skin folds, making your sphynx feel greasy and creating an ideal environment for bacteria and yeast to grow. Yeast and bacterial skin infections are not uncommon in both dogs and cats, but they are almost always secondary infections. This is because sphynx cats hair follicles do not produce normal keratin (the protein that hair consists of), and they, therefore, have very fine or rudimentary hairs. The main difference between Malassezia and fungal skin infection (like ringworm) is that fungi are multi-cell organisms and reproduce through a different mechanism (producing spores). These microbes will only cause infection if the skin barrier is compromised, for example, if the immune system is suppressed or underdeveloped (as in very young kittens) or if there is another cause for skin inflammation, such as an allergic reaction. Along with Malassezia, some of the normal bacteria living on the skin, such as staphylococcus species, may also take advantage of the compromised skin barrier and cause a secondary bacterial infection. Skin allergies can be due to several causes such as environmental (for example, pollen), food intolerance, flea bite allergy, or contact dermatitis (allergy to materials such as plastic food bowls, certain types of metal, or cat litter).
